Recycled textiles are transforming the global textile and apparel industry by offering sustainable alternatives to virgin fibers. Produced from post-consumer and post-industrial waste, these textiles reduce landfill accumulation, lower carbon emissions, and conserve natural resources such as water and energy. Rising consumer awareness, stringent environmental regulations, and growing demand for sustainable fashion are key factors fueling the growth of the recycled textile market across fashion, industrial, and automotive sectors.

In the fashion sector, recycled textiles are widely used in clothing, footwear, and accessories, helping brands implement circular economy strategies. Automotive applications include seat fabrics, insulation, and interior trims, while industrial applications range from packaging to insulation materials and filtration products. Advances in recycling technology, including chemical and mechanical fiber recovery, have improved the quality, strength, and texture of recycled fibers, making them competitive with virgin materials.

Regionally, Asia-Pacific dominates the market due to high textile production, availability of waste materials, and increasing consumer demand for eco-friendly products in countries like China, India, and Bangladesh. Europe focuses on sustainable fashion and industrial applications, supported by strict environmental regulations and eco-labeling initiatives. North America emphasizes circular economy models and sustainable apparel, while emerging markets in Latin America and the Middle East are gradually adopting recycled textiles, presenting additional growth opportunities.
